【Background technology】
It is the typical labor-intensive enterprises by multiple working procedure in the industry of production oil pump nozzle plunger bushing, there are technologies to want
The features such as asking height, processing technology complexity, low production efficiency, high production cost, plunger bushing precision pair is in oil pump nozzle component
Vital part, most domestic manufacturer still takes original processing technology, typically uses turning plunger
It covers external form and two master operation of drill bushing hole produces plunger, wherein turning plunger bushing external form is the specification bar use in a scale
Sawing machine carries out blanking sawing, and the outer circle of segmentation cutting different-diameter is carried out on same plunger sleeve blank to reach work with small size lathe
Skill requirement, and the end that the bar of sawing is carried out by sawing machine is required to be polished by Plane surface grinding machine, in the prior art, generally
Plunger bushing blank is fixed using common fixing device, working efficiency is low, inconvenient to use.Therefore, it is necessary to one kind
The plunger sleeve fixture mechanism of plunger bushing end face Plane surface grinding machine.

The course of work of the present invention:
A kind of plunger sleeve fixture mechanism of plunger bushing grinding machine of the present invention with feeding device easy to use during the work time,
By 10 pile of plunger bushing blank on putting flitch 16, the piston rod for then starting driving cylinder 191 stretches out drive square promotion
Plate 192 is moved to 112 direction of discharge port, and square pushing plate 192 pushes the plunger bushing blank for putting that top layer discharges on flitch 16
10 by discharge port 112 and into reclaiming plate 113, and the piston rod retraction for then starting driving cylinder 191 drives square promotion
Plate 192 returns to initial position, and after plunger bushing blank 10 enters reclaiming plate 113, (due to front end and the axis body 114 of reclaiming plate 113
The distance between be less than the distance between rear end and the axis body 114 of reclaiming plate 113) compel to use by the gravity of plunger bushing blank 10
Flitch 113 rotates clockwise, and so that reclaiming plate 113 is changed from horizontality to heeling condition, until the front end of reclaiming plate 113 is shelved
Discharge groove body 182 it is high-end on, at this point, the plunger bushing blank 10 on reclaiming plate 113 under self gravitation effect automatically into
(after the plunger bushing blank on reclaiming plate 113 exports completely, reclaiming plate 113 is inverse under the action of tension spring 115 for discharge groove body 182
Hour hands rotation is shelved on again on block body 116), the piston rod stretching for then starting pusher cylinder 183 drives scraping wings 184 will most
The feeding of plunger bushing blank 10 of lower position polishes equipment, and then the piston rod of pusher cylinder 183, which is retracted, drives scraping wings 184 to return to
Initial position prepares push next time material, and whenever pusher 19 works once, Driving Stepping Motor 111 just drives threaded rod 14
Primary with the rotation of identical stepping beat, the rotation of threaded rod 14 drives lifting seat 15 to be moved upwards with identical stepping beat, lifting seat
15 drives are put flitch 16 and are moved upwards, and put the plunger bushing blank of pile on flitch 16 with rising together, realize step feeding.
